On Tue, 2006-11-07 at 22:29 +0000, Christoph Hellwig wrote:
> On Mon, Nov 06, 2006 at 06:12:11PM +0530, Amol Lad wrote:
> > Replaced save_flags()/cli() with spin_lock alternatives
> This patch has very little chance to work as-is because it only replaces
> cli with spinlocks, but not the irq handler it's locking against.
> 
It protects against irq handler also. 

drivers/scsi/NCR53C9x.c:

irqreturn_t esp_intr(int irq, void *dev_id)
{
    struct NCR_ESP *esp;
    unsigned long flags;
    int again;
    struct Scsi_Host *dev = dev_id;
    /* Handle all ESP interrupts showing at this IRQ level. */
    spin_lock_irqsave(dev->host_lock, flags);
...
...
}
